Locum Dentist / Great Ayton, North Yorkshire / £500 Per Day
MBR Dental are currently assisting a dental practice located in Great Ayton, North Yorkshire to recruit a Locum Dentist to join their team on a temporary basis.
- Available as soon as possible.
- Ongoing till permanent Dentist recruited.
- Part time opportunity, 2 days per week.
- Surgery space Monday and Friday, 8.30am-5.15pm.
- Practice can offer £500 per day.
- Dentist will be managing a mixed list.
- Dentist will have support from a Therapist.
- 3 surgery dental practice.
- Computerised (SFD) with Digital X-Rays and Rotary Endo.
- Great support network in place, including an onsite Clinical Lead.
- Town centre location with parking available.
All Dentists must be registered with the GDC and hold an active Performer Number to be considered. An Enhanced DBS Certificate will be required on request.
